Matthew Roche
@matthewroche
Seasoned software engineer with expertise in the latest technologies.
What I'm looking for
I am a seasoned software engineer with a strong background in leading digital transformation initiatives and delivering high-quality software solutions. My experience spans various roles, including Group Head of Software Development and Head of Software Development, where I have successfully driven technology adoption and process optimization to align with business objectives.
Throughout my career, I have demonstrated my ability to enhance user experiences and improve system functionalities. Notable achievements include developing a robust expense tracking application and enhancing betting platform features, which significantly improved customer engagement. I am passionate about mentoring teams and fostering a culture of continuous learning, ensuring that we not only meet but exceed our project goals.
Experience
Work history, roles, and key accomplishments
Group Head of Software Development
Magaya Mining
Oct 2024 - Mar 2025 (5 months)
Led the digital transformation throughout the organization, providing strategic insight on technology adoption and process optimization. Responsible for identifying key areas for improvement, working with external development companies, and ensuring cohesion between all systems.
Head of Software Development
Moors World of Sport
Aug 2022 - Sep 2024 (2 years 1 month)
Led product development and IT projects for sports betting and online casino platforms, focusing on internal systems and platform integrations. Developed a robust expense tracking application and enhanced betting platform features.
Software Developer | IT Manager
Fivet Animal Health
Jan 2019 - Jul 2022 (3 years 6 months)
Contributed to multiple projects utilizing React, Node.js, MySQL, and MongoDB, developing systems like a Loyalty Card Analysis system and a Procurement System. Responsibilities included network administration, server maintenance, and implementing security protocols.
Instructional Designer
EDGE Learning Media
Sep 2018 - Feb 2019 (5 months)
Designed and developed storyboards to supplement coursework for Network Administration and Network Engineering modules at the university level. This involved creating educational content for second-year students.
Junior Software Developer
Adept Software
Jan 2018 - Jun 2018 (5 months)
Developed software solutions for the freight management industry, focusing on tracking, managing, and delivering packages efficiently. Contributed to improving logistics operations through software.
Education
Degrees, certifications, and relevant coursework
Rhodes University
Bachelor of Science (with Honours), Computer Science
Completed a Bachelor of Science with Honours in Computer Science. This program provided advanced knowledge and specialized skills in the field of computer science.
Rhodes University
Bachelor of Science, Information Systems
Grade: Distinction in Computer Science
Obtained a Bachelor of Science in Information Systems with Distinction in Computer Science. Majored in Computer Science and Information Systems, gaining a strong foundation in both theoretical and practical aspects.
St. Georges College
A Levels, Applied ICT, Geography, Mathematics
Completed Cambridge International A Levels. Studied Applied ICT, Geography, and Mathematics, developing a strong academic background.
St. Georges College
IGCSE, Biology, Business Studies, English, Geography, Mathematics, Physical Sciences
Completed Cambridge International IGCSE. Studied Biology, Business Studies, English, Geography, Mathematics, and Physical Sciences, building a broad educational foundation.
Tech stack
Software and tools used professionally
Availability
Location
Authorized to work in
Job categories
Interested in hiring Matthew?
You can contact Matthew and 90k+ other talented remote workers on Himalayas.
Message MatthewFind your dream job
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!
